Objective: To use liquid chromatography-mass spectrometry techniques for qualitative analysis of alkaloids of Morus alba L. leaves and determine the content of total alkaloids in alkaloids in Morus alba L. leaves by HPLC-UV with pre-column derivatization. Method: The chromatographic separation was performed on a HiQSiL C18 column(250 mm×4.6 mm
5 μm) using acetonitrile and 0.1% acetic acid aqueous solution under isocratic elution(50:50
V/V) at a flow rate of 0.8 mL.min-1. Morus alba L. leaves alkaloids was analyzed with 9-fluorenylmethyl chlorformate(FMOC-Cl) as the pre-column derivative agent. Detection wavelength was set at 254 nm with electrospray ionization source(ESI) and positive ion mode. And 1-deoxynojirimycin as the external standard to calculate mulberry leaf total alkaloid content. Result: Six alkaloid compounds were identified as DNJ
fagomine
3-epi-fagomine
DAB
Calystegine B2 and 2-O-β-Glc-DAB.The content of 3 batches test samples were more than 75% by external standard method. Conclusion: The method is sensitive
accurate
simple
and reliable. It can be used for quantitative analysis of Morus alba L. leaves alkaloids and preparation.
